A story in the news lately confirms that Guantánamo has long been a pedophile's playground for the U.S. military. Kirby Logan Archer, a military police investigator at Guantánamo during the 1990s balsero crisis, was recently plucked from a life boat in the Florida Straits along with a Cuban teenager when the chartered boat on which he hoped to flee to Communist Cuba disappeared along with its 4-man crew. The fugitive Archer, a suspect in a $92,600 theft from an Arkansas Walmart, was apparently attempting to defect to Cuba with the teenager whom he first met when he and his family were confined at Guantánamo more than ten years ago. Archer maintained contact with him since his arrival in the U.S. and Archer's ex-wife claims that as a boy the Cuban teenager had even vacationed in their home in Arkansas. The Archers' marriage ended recently when she came out as a lesbian and Archer as a homosexual.

It has been assumed that Kirby Archer was fleeing to the island because he was wanted in connection with the Arkansas theft. It seems more probable, though, that the theft was committed in order to provide him with the funds to flee to Cuba with his teenage victim. Once Cuba is free, we shall still have the open sore of Guantánamo Naval Base to deal with. The best thing would for those gates to stay locked until the U.S. is ready to return to Cuba what it leased "in perpetuity" 106 years ago against every precept of international law, which forbids an occupying power (as the U.S. was then) to annex the territory of an occupied country, which is in effect what the U.S. did under the ruse of a "perpetual lease."

Later the U.S. made matters worse by using Guantánamo not as a naval coaling station (which was the ostensible and now long-obsolete reason for which it was "leased"), but as a detention camp both for Cubans and foreign nationals. Guantánamo is not and has never been U.S. territory. The uses of a military base are not limitless. Guantánamo is in no way an overseas colony of the U.S.; nor does the U.S. enjoy extraterritoriality there. It is Cuba's situation at this time that has allowed the U.S. to abuse the norms of international law and usage to create a de facto American colony at Guantánamo. While this situation persists there can be no "normal relations" between the U.S. and Cuba even after the end of the Castro era.

Ironically, if not for Castro the lease on Guantánamo would have been terminated at the time that jurisdiction over the Panama Canal was returned to Panama. Now it may not be that easy to eliminate this last vestige of jingoism and putrid legacy of the Platt Amendment.
